The Role of UX/UI Design in Custom Software Development

In the digital epoch where technology and business converge, the emphasis on user experience (UX) and user interface (UI) design in custom software development has never been greater. As founders and CXOs of startups and mid-sized companies, understanding the pivotal role of UX/UI design can dramatically influence the success of your software solutions. In this article, we’ll delve into how effective UX/UI design not only enhances user engagement but also ensures that the software meets your strategic business goals.

Understanding UX/UI Design

Before we explore their specific roles, it’s crucial to demystify what UX and UI design entail.

  • User Experience (UX) refers to the overall experience a user has when interacting with a product or service, focusing on usability, accessibility, and the satisfaction derived from the user’s interaction. Simply put, good UX design makes a product easy to use and enjoyable.

  • User Interface (UI), on the other hand, refers to the aesthetic elements that users interact with, such as buttons, icons, spacing, and layouts. A well-designed UI not only attracts users but also supports UX design by ensuring that users can navigate through the software intuitively.

Both are integral to the design and usability of custom software solutions. When effectively merged, they provide a seamless experience that keeps users engaged and coming back.

Why UX/UI Design Matters in Custom Software Development

1. Enhancing User Satisfaction

At the heart of any software application lies its purpose: to solve a problem. Whether it’s a startup looking to disrupt the market or a mid-sized company aiming to streamline operations, ensuring that users find value in your software is paramount.

According to a study by Forrester, a well-designed user interface could raise a website’s conversion rate by up to 200%, and a better UX design could yield conversion rates up to 400%. In custom software development, where user satisfaction is critical, partnering with an experienced team for UX/UI design can help improve user adoption rates, reduce churn, and enhance overall customer loyalty.

2. Driving Business Goals

Custom software is not just a tool; it’s an extension of your company’s brand and vision. Effective UX/UI design aligns with your business strategy by making the user’s journey a critical focus of development efforts. This process starts with clearly defining the problem your software intends to solve, followed by in-depth research on user behavior and preferences.

At Celestiq, we ensure that our custom software solutions are designed with business objectives in mind, thus maximizing the potential for achieving desired outcomes. Our UX/UI design process enables you to address questions like:

  • How does the software serve your clients?
  • What challenges do users face?
  • What metrics are necessary to gauge success?

3. Innate Usability and Accessibility

One of the core principles of UX/UI design is usability—making sure that software is intuitive and accessible to different user personas. This means considering various factors like:

  • Diverse Skill Levels: Users might range from tech-savvy individuals to those with minimal digital experience.
  • Disability Considerations: Accessibility for users with disabilities should be embedded in the software’s design to ensure inclusivity.

Adopting best practices for usability enhances the overall user experience, making it easier for individuals to navigate and accomplish their tasks with minimal frustration.

4. Efficient Development Processes

An often-overlooked aspect of integrating UX/UI design into custom software development is its role in streamlining the development process. By implementing UX/UI strategies early in the project, development teams can:

  • Identify potential challenges ahead of time
  • Create more accurate timelines and estimates
  • Reduce costly revisions in later stages of development

Ultimately, this foresight translates to cost savings and faster time to market, crucial elements for startups and mid-sized companies looking to maintain a competitive edge.

5. Informed Decision-Making Through Testing

In the world of custom software development, the iterative process is vital. Prototyping and A/B testing are common methods used to gauge the effectiveness of UI designs and overall user experience. This helps in refining ideas based on real user feedback rather than assumptions.

Investing in a robust UX/UI design phase allows teams at Celestiq to validate concepts through testing, enabling you to make data-driven decisions. This reduces risks associated with launching new features or making significant changes.

Case Studies: Success Through Design

Example 1: Project Management Software for a Startup

A startup approached Celestiq with a vision to create a project management tool tailored for remote teams. They faced challenges attracting users due to an overly complex interface and high dropout rates during onboarding.

By implementing a user-centered design approach, we simplified the software’s interface while enhancing functionality. Utilizing personas and user journeys allowed us to refine the onboarding experience. As a result, user engagement increased by over 75%, significantly boosting customer acquisition.

Example 2: E-commerce Solutions for a Mid-Sized Company

A mid-sized e-commerce company enlisted our help for a custom software solution to improve their online store. Initial audits revealed prevalent cart abandonment due to a confusing checkout process.

Partnering with our UX/UI team, we reimagined the user journey by streamlining the checkout flow, making it intuitive and error-resistant. Once implemented, the company observed a 30% improvement in conversion rates, translating to an additional revenue stream.

Key Principles for Engaging UX/UI Design

When embarking on your custom software development journey, consider these key principles that can propel your project to success:

1. User-Centric Approach

Begin with a clear understanding of your target audience. Conduct market research and user interviews to gather insights and preferences.

2. Consistency is Key

Maintain a coherent visual language and interactive design across the application. This fosters familiarity, boosting confidence among users navigating your software.

3. Feedback Loop

Incorporate feedback from users throughout the design and development process. Early feedback helps in quickly identifying pain points and implementing solutions.

4. Regular Iteration

Never settle with the first version. Instead, continually iterate based on user feedback and analytics. This ongoing process ensures that the software evolves in alignment with user expectations.

Conclusion

The integration of UX/UI design into custom software development is not merely an aesthetic choice; it directly impacts business outcomes and user satisfaction. As founders and CXOs, recognizing the importance of user-centered design can transform your software into a market leader.

At Celestiq, we understand that successful custom solutions stem from marrying robust development processes with thoughtful design. Embracing a strategic approach to UX/UI can drive user engagement, foster customer loyalty, and achieve your business goals efficiently.

If you’re ready to elevate your custom software solution through exceptional UX/UI design, explore what Celestiq can offer. We specialize in developing tailored software solutions that cater to your unique business requirements and facilitate growth.

Learn more about our services at Celestiq Custom Software Development Company and our approach to MVP Development.

Transform your ideas into impactful realities—partner with Celestiq today!

Start typing and press Enter to search